Abstract: | The influence of temperature (75-100°C), ammonia concentration in solution (1-5%), and oxygen pressure (1-8 MPa) on the yield of the target product (insoluble residue) and nitrogen content in this product in treatment of pine bark with oxygen in aqueous ammonia (oxidative ammonolysis) was studied. The resulting samples were tested in agriculture as nitrogen-containing fertilizers. |
